Pros

The place is one where you are given a lot of freedom to make a contribution in the way you best see fit, as long as they see it fitting into the overall picture. Quite a bit of professional development built into the marketing/product manufacturing function.

Cons

Ownership has changed and the culture seems to have changed a little bit away from the personal feel it once had. This may give way to better opportunity with the new ownership and growth opportunities outside of the company proper.

Pros

The overall work environment is very laid back and low stress.

Cons

The compensation is low based on industry averages and advancement opportunities are close to non-existent. Benefits are pretty standard. Another review mentioned that the company promotes based on years of service rather than merit and it's absolutely true.
